Upon release, she begins a new life in Paris, where she takes a lover. Pregnant, Jane leaves for the French Alps to have her baby. But she becomes convinced she is being stalked by the demon who can take on human form. After Jane's baby is born, she says her child was kidnapped, while authorities accuse her of murder. In Dangerous Angel, this chilling novel by Susie Reynolds, Jane's life is told through her journals, which offer a glimpse into the repressive church and the strict moral codes of the fifties. Author Susie Reynolds grew up in the West Midlands of England and attended college in Liverpool. She is a drama teacher and also edits and writes for a magazine. She now lives in Brittany, France, and frequently visits Paris and its churches, where much of this book was set. Reynolds is currently working on her second novel. 284 pp. Englisch.
